This therapeutic intervention represents a method of pain management available to individuals residing in a specific metropolitan area within Oklahoma. The approach involves the use of a device implanted to deliver mild electrical impulses to the spinal cord, thereby disrupting pain signals before they reach the brain. This can provide relief for individuals experiencing chronic pain conditions that have not responded to more conservative treatments. A patient, for instance, suffering from failed back surgery syndrome might be a candidate for this type of therapy.

The potential advantages of this intervention include a reduction in reliance on opioid medications and an improved quality of life through pain mitigation.   • Trial Period and Temporary Leads

    Before committing to permanent implantation, a trial period offers a glimpse of what life could be like. Temporary leads are inserted, and the stimulator is worn externally. This phase is critical. Imagine a patient finally able to walk without wincing, to sleep through the night, or to engage in simple activities long abandoned. The trials outcome dictates whether proceeding with the permanent device makes sense, grounding the decision in tangible experience rather than abstract hope.

  • Surgical Precision and Lead Placement

    The procedure itself is a carefully orchestrated ballet of surgical precision. The surgeon, guided by imaging and expertise, navigates to the epidural space near the spinal cord. Leads, thin wires with electrodes, are meticulously positioned to target the specific areas responsible for transmitting pain signals. Even a millimeter of misplacement can affect the stimulators efficacy. Its a delicate balance of science and art, where knowledge of anatomy meets the nuances of individual physiology.

  • Generator Implantation and System Integration

    Once the leads are securely in place, the generator, the device’s power source and control center, is implanted, typically in the buttock or abdomen. The generator is connected to the leads, completing the system. Post-implantation, the system must be programmed and calibrated to the patients specific needs. This involves fine-tuning the stimulation parameters to achieve optimal pain relief while minimizing side effects. The integration of the device into the patient’s nervous system is a process of continuous refinement, a collaborative effort between the medical team and the individual.

  • Post-operative Care and Long-term Management

    The procedure is not the end but rather the beginning of a long-term commitment to pain management. Post-operative care is crucial for healing and preventing complications. Regular follow-up appointments are necessary to monitor the device’s performance, adjust settings as needed, and provide ongoing support. Furthermore, patients require education on how to manage their device, including charging the battery and troubleshooting common issues. The long-term success of the spinal cord stimulator hinges on the patient’s active participation and the medical team’s unwavering support.

Frequently Asked Questions about Spinal Cord Stimulators in Oklahoma City

The questions surrounding chronic pain management, specifically regarding the availability of a therapy using electrical impulses near the spine in this locale, are often numerous. The following attempts to address common inquiries, providing context and clarity to what is frequently a complex decision-making process.

Question 1: Is this procedure a guaranteed cure for chronic pain?

No. A “cure” implies complete eradication, and that is not the aim. The objective is pain management. Visualize a dimmer switch, not an on/off toggle. The intervention seeks to reduce the intensity of pain signals, providing a measure of relief that allows for increased functionality and improved quality of life. Success varies, and depends on proper patient selection, careful surgical execution, and diligent participation in rehabilitation.

Question 2: How long does the device last, and what happens when the battery runs out?

The lifespan varies, dependent on device type and usage patterns. Some have non-rechargeable batteries lasting several years, necessitating surgical replacement of the generator when depleted. Others feature rechargeable batteries requiring periodic charging, potentially lasting much longer. Regular monitoring appointments with the medical team are essential to assess battery status and plan accordingly.

Question 3: Can this device be felt, and does it interfere with daily activities?

Some individuals report a mild tingling sensation, often described as a pleasant massage-like sensation. The intensity is adjustable, controlled by the patient within pre-set parameters. Modern devices are designed to minimize interference with daily activities. However, certain activities involving significant bending, twisting, or impact might require temporary adjustment or deactivation of the device.

Question 4: What are the potential risks and complications associated with the procedure?

As with any surgical intervention, risks exist. These include infection, bleeding, lead migration (displacement of the wires), device malfunction, and adverse reactions to anesthesia. These risks are relatively low, but require careful consideration and open communication with the medical team. Adherence to post-operative instructions is crucial to minimize complications.

Question 5: How do physicians in Oklahoma City determine if someone is a suitable candidate?

A thorough evaluation process is undertaken. This typically involves a comprehensive medical history, physical examination, psychological assessment, and diagnostic imaging. Failure to respond to more conservative treatments (medications, physical therapy) is often a prerequisite. A trial period, using a temporary external stimulator, is typically conducted to assess the individual’s response to the therapy before permanent implantation is considered.

Question 6: Will insurance cover the cost of this procedure in Oklahoma City?

Coverage varies dependent on the insurance provider and the specific policy. Pre-authorization is typically required. Often, documentation demonstrating failure of other treatments and meeting specific medical necessity criteria is needed to secure approval. Patient advocacy groups and financial counselors can offer assistance in navigating the insurance process.
